Roxy Music's Bryan Ferry was on an amazing roll in 1974. See why his live cover of 'Sympathy for the Devil' is a Song You Need to Know
were at their height, carving out their unique, glammy art-rock space as they made great albums at a yearly clip. At the same time, Ferry was putting out his own solo records, starting with 1973’s near-perfect covers collection. Just as Ferry’s tuxedoed smoothness and Old World charm stood out among the grease-haired prog-rockers of the era like Jay Gatsby hanging out at, his solo music was completely in its own visionary world.
The highlight might be Ferry’s show-opening race through the Rolling Stones’ “Sympathy for the Devil,” all diabolical swing and Continental cool, as if Lucifer is riding his tank through a casino in Monte Carlo. Hear it here.
